P270A
Transmission Friction Element A Temperature Too High
Friction element A inside the automatic transmission has reached over-temperature. Excessive slip during shifts or trailer towing burns the clutch.

Possible causes
- Excessive slip due to worn clutch or low pressure high
- Restricted transmission fluid cooler medium
- Sustained heavy load such as trailer towing medium
Symptoms
- Check engine or transmission warning light on
- Harsh, delayed, or missing shifts
- Possible limp mode (locked in one gear)
- Slipping or shuddering during gear changes
